Technically, Google Forms doesn't have an electronic signature feature or an add-on that can be used. Instead, Google Forms users devise workarounds, like including a field for users to type in their initials to indicate they accept that as an eSignature alternative. -

Add an Invisible Digital Signature Open your document and click the File tab. Click Info and then click Protect Document. From the Protect Document drop-down menu, click Add a Digital Signature. Select a Commitment Type, such as created and approved this document, and then click Sign. -

[Music] quite often Potter's will create a makers mark stamp it could perhaps be initials or just a design or symbol that they want to use to press on the side or the bottom of their pieces to help identify their piece it is their makers mark it's their Potter stamp this video I want to show you a little bit about how I would go about carving a stamp such as one of these and some of the things to watch out for and some of the tools that we're going to use is to try to keep your stamps small approximately dime or a penny size you can see that these over here are a little bit smaller they print a little bit better this particular one is a little bit larger than the penny it's a little bit more difficult to stamp it's so a great stamp but it's not so effective as a signature stamp so for my students when you are designing yours keep your stamps small penny or dime size these two cups show the same or similar stamp that is used in a way to stamp my maker's mark just a simple W here in this one I stamped the cup itself this one I stamped basically a flattened P that I slipped and scored to the cup and then I stamped the soft P sometimes I do that if I have neglected to stamp the cup before it gets past the leather hard State beginning a stamp is fairly easy for my students we are using the earthenware clay that has no grog in it so it's the standard one 103 clay and I'm going to start off by pinching a little hunk about the size of a cherry tomato now one end I'm going to smooth because that's going to be the stamp surface and I'm going to squeeze the side then to become the handle and then I'm going to take that surface and then tap it on the table so as you tap it it becomes flattened and at this point as you flatten it you can begin to shape it so hypothetically if I wanted to have a square stamp I can begin to pinch it a little bit square and then progressively tap it and pinch tap and pinch now if you squeeze it in like what I'm doing right here I don't know if you can see this but there's a dent that's occurring there you want to make sure that you always end up with a flat stamp face if you can't get it flat by tapping you can eventually just take a knife and you can trim it off so this is how you start off by making the basic stamp blank I will make another video that demonstrates the technique for making a small little roller I'm just gonna skip over it in this one but the small rollers are really quite nice to add some rolling textures now once you have the stamp face made you have the stamp blank you need to get it to the leather hard State once it's leather hard then you're ready to do your cleaning and your carving so the first thing that I'm going to do on this is if it's not completely flat as I had mentioned before you can easily just shave it all flat okay if your edges need to be say a slightly different edge like it a slightly different shape there like you wanted it's more square you can easily take and just kind of shave that for greater precision and then once you you get the the top of it and the outside of it tidy looking really the way that you want it to then let's talk about your design so my students I've given you a little sketch sheet where you've thought about your design but remember that first of all if you have anything that could pretend we print backwards you need to actually carve it backward so like the letter R would have to be carved as such if you wanted to do initials like RPG you would have to draw them completely mirror image and the other thing is you want to think about what do you want do you want a an image where the background is carved away or do you want to image where the the lines of the image are carved away so in the case of mine I'm going to do this I'm going to do a W with a square around it now to begin I will start by drawing a square and then I will put the W inside of it now since I'm gonna carve away some of the background and I do keep a little dry brush on him so I can just kind of knock away the debris so since I'm going to carve away the background I'm going to draw this as a block W a block letter instead of a single line so I'm going to just outline it and let's dust this off and hopefully you can kind of see the outline so far now depending on how big of an area you're cutting away it might depend on what you want to use to cut a needletool is great if you want to dig something out but if you want to go a little bit faster you can use some of these ribbon tools these are Kemper miniature ribbon tools I will put links to these in the video description these are really great tools for carving away small clean areas so this is the triangle tip I like the triangle tip because I'm going to use this flat the straight edge and I'm going to go straight down along that straight edge of where the square is okay and I'm gonna take another flat edge right up against the W okay I'm gonna do this one same way I'll go ahead and carve this and then I'll show you how to clean all right so I've carved away some of the back background area but now what I would like to do is give it more precision because this is kind of ambiguous I've lost the sharpness of detail that I would like so now I'm going to take the needle tool and I'm going to re outline that background carving and then I'm gonna re outline the side of the W so hopefully you can see the difference between the the left side that I just carved a little bit more sharply in the right side it doesn't have to be super deep but it has to be deep enough that it's gonna print well okay now I'm gonna go ahead and do the other I'm gonna again I'm gonna outline the rectangle and then I'm going to outline the W [Music] alright so I've done the outside and the bottom and I'm gonna do the inside and upper part now one thing did just happen that I was afraid might happen the tiny little tip of the W just broke off so in a case like this I have a water dish and a small brush I'm gonna add a little drop of water right onto that craft area that's gonna help glue it back on all right that's looking a little bit better now I'm gonna take that tiny paintbrush that I used to anchor the that broken tip back on and I'm just gonna go in there I'm going to clean up really those the the edges so if I have any little slightly bumpy area this will clean it up your your goal with this is to have a crispness of detail that's going to print nicely so when you go to print it on leather hard or soft clay you will get that nice crisp crisp detail of your design showing up [Music] [Applause] [Music] all right I think I'm pretty pleased with that so I really was going for crispness of the edges I wanted the background to look fairly uniform arrant little bumps or pieces that have broken off I feel like I have corrected that and lastly you as my students you will need to put your name or initials on it so I'm going to put W W and then you would put your bell that way if it gets separated we can get it back in your class cabinet and if you did make a second and you could certainly do a stamp on the second end I was just going to carve like a little kind of a pyramid looking pattern in this so I'd make it like a nice little texture if you wanted to do something like that you certainly could use it not necessarily as a stamp but as a that'll make a great little texture when it fires and that is how you carve a little signature stamp or a makers mark stamp and try to make something exciting and fun that will represent you [Music]
